[0001] The present disclosure relates to a driving skill improvement system. [Background technology]
[0002] BACKGROUND ART Services aimed at improving a driver's vehicle driving skills have been known for some time.
[0003] For example, Patent Document 1 discloses a vehicle environmental service system having an in-vehicle information terminal installed in a vehicle, a center server installed in a center, and an operator terminal managed by an affiliated service operator that provides various services to users, wherein the in-vehicle information terminal or the center server has a point calculation means that determines, for each user, whether the user is driving safely and / or driving in an environmentally friendly manner based on predetermined criteria, and calculates the number of points to be awarded based on the determination result, the center server has a database that accumulates the number of points awarded to each user and manages the total number of points, the operator terminal has a service provision means that provides a predetermined service in exchange for a predetermined number of points in the database, and an advertisement generation means that generates advertisement information related to the affiliated service operator, and the in-vehicle information terminal has a means for receiving the advertisement information from the operator terminal directly or via the center server.
[0004] Patent Document 2 discloses a driving diagnosis information providing device including a vehicle information acquiring means for acquiring vehicle information representing the vehicle state, a diagnostic means for diagnosing the driving state of the vehicle based on the vehicle information acquired by the vehicle information acquiring means, and a notification means for notifying the driver of the diagnostic information representing the diagnosis result of the diagnostic means, the driving diagnosis information providing device further including a useful information acquiring means for acquiring at least one of contact information to be notified to the driver and useful information that is information useful for driving, and the notification means is configured to notify the driver of the information acquired by the useful information acquiring means instead of the diagnostic information under predetermined conditions. Patent Document 2 further discloses that the useful information includes notice information such as advertising information and one-line advice such as trivia about driving. [Prior art documents] [Patent documents]
[0005] [Patent Document 1] Japanese Patent Application Laid-Open No. 2007-293626 [Patent Document 2] Japanese Patent Application Laid-Open No. 2010-039640 Summary of the Invention [Problem to be solved by the invention]
[0006] According to the conventional technologies disclosed in Patent Documents 1 and 2, a driver's vehicle driving skill is determined, and advertising information related to incentives such as coupons or points is notified to the driver. However, the advertising information in the conventional technologies is not necessarily information that leads to an improvement in the driver's vehicle driving skill, and there is room for improvement. One possible solution is to notify the driver of service advertisements to improve the driver's vehicle driving skill, but drivers whose driving skill is higher than the standard may find the service advertisements annoying.
[0007] The purpose of the present disclosure, made in consideration of such circumstances, is to provide technology that increases the advertising effectiveness of service advertisements aimed at improving the driving skills of drivers whose driving skills are below standard, thereby improving their driving skills, while preventing drivers whose driving skills are above standard from feeling annoyed by the service advertisements. [Means for solving the problem]
[0008] A driving skill improvement system according to one embodiment of the present disclosure is a driving skill improvement system that aims to improve a driver's vehicle driving skills, and is equipped with one or more processors and one or more memories communicatively connected to the one or more processors, wherein the one or more processors perform the following: determining the driver's driving skill; and based on the driving skill determination result, notifying the driver of a first service advertisement, which is an advertisement for a service that can be used to improve the driver's driving skill; and the notification frequency of the first service advertisement when the driver's driving skill is not determined to be higher than a predetermined standard is higher than the notification frequency of the first service advertisement when the driver's driving skill is determined to be higher than the predetermined standard. [Effects of the Invention]
[0009] According to one embodiment of the present disclosure, it is possible to improve the driving skills of drivers whose driving skills are lower than the standard by increasing the advertising effectiveness of service advertisements to improve their driving skills, while preventing drivers whose driving skills are higher than the standard from feeling annoyed by the service advertisements. [0050] (Driving Skill Assessment Department) The driving skill assessment unit 313 determines whether the driver's driving skill is higher than a predetermined standard based on the driving data acquired by the driving data acquisition unit 312. Specifically, the driving skill assessment unit 313 determines the driver's driving skill based on a comparison between the driving data acquired by the driving data acquisition unit 312 and model driving data pre-stored in the memory unit 320. More specifically, the driving skill assessment unit 313 compares the accelerator pedal and brake pedal operation amounts and the steering angle of the steering wheel 6 included in the driving data with the accelerator pedal and brake pedal operation amounts and the steering angle of the steering wheel 6 included in the model driving data. The driving skill assessment unit 313 then determines the driver's driving skill by calculating a deviation degree for each of the comparison results. Note that the driving skill assessment unit 313 may determine that the lower the average value of the calculated deviation degrees, the higher the driver's driving skill. However, the method for evaluating driving skill in the present disclosure is not limited to this, and any known or arbitrary evaluation method can be adopted.

[0053] The notification information setting unit 314 may set the content of the service related to the first service advertisement based on the usage history of the service related to the first service advertisement by multiple drivers and the improvement effect on the driving skills of the multiple drivers. In this case, information indicating the usage history by multiple drivers and the improvement effect on driving skills is pre-stored in the storage unit 320 so that it can be referenced by the notification information setting unit 314. Here, the "improvement effect on driving skills" may mean, for example, that the average value of the deviation from the above-mentioned exemplary driving data decreases as the number of times the driver drives the vehicle 100 increases, but the present disclosure is not limited thereto. Specifically, the notification information setting unit 314 may determine the content of the first service advertisement based on the ratio of the number of users whose driving skills have improved by a predetermined amount to the number of users of the service related to the first service advertisement. More specifically, the notification information setting unit 314 may set, as notification information, an effective service advertisement, which is a first service advertisement whose ratio is equal to or greater than a predetermined threshold (e.g., 0.5), from among the multiple first service advertisements. The notification information setting unit 314 may also set to give priority to notifying an effective service advertisement, which is a first service advertisement whose ratio is equal to or greater than a predetermined threshold (e.g., 0.5) and whose ratio deviates more from the predetermined threshold, among a plurality of first service advertisements. Details of the notification frequency of effective service advertisements will be described later.
[0054] The notification information setting unit 314 may set the content of a coupon or points that can be used when using the service related to the first service advertisement together with the first service advertisement, based on the usage history of the service related to the first service advertisement by multiple drivers and the improvement effect of the driving skills of the multiple drivers. Specifically, the notification information setting unit 314 may determine the content of the coupon or points based on the ratio of the number of people whose driving skills have improved by a predetermined amount to the total number of users of the service related to the first service advertisement. More specifically, the notification information setting unit 314 may set the coupon discount amount or the number of points to be awarded so that the greater the ratio is equal to or greater than a predetermined threshold (e.g., 0.5) and the greater the deviation of the ratio from the predetermined threshold (e.g., 0.5), the greater the discount amount of the coupon or the number of points to be awarded.

[0058] (Notification frequency setting section) The notification frequency setting unit 315 sets the notification frequency of the first service advertisement when the driving skill of the driver determined by the driving skill determination unit 313 is not determined to be higher than the predetermined standard to be higher than the notification frequency of the first service advertisement when the driving skill of the driver is determined to be higher than the predetermined standard. Note that the notification frequency of the first service advertisement set by this method is, for example, once every few minutes to tens of minutes, but the present disclosure is not particularly limited and can be set as appropriate. Furthermore, the notification frequency of the first service advertisement set by this method may be set to be higher as the driving skill is lower than the predetermined standard.
[0059] The notification frequency setting unit 315 may set the notification frequency of the effective service advertisement set by the notification information setting unit 314, among the notification frequencies of the first service advertisement set by the above-mentioned method, to be higher than the notification frequency of the first service advertisement other than the effective service advertisement.
[0060] The notification frequency setting unit 315 may set the notification frequency of the second service advertisement higher than the notification frequency of the first service advertisement when the driving skill determination unit 313 determines that the driver's driving skill is higher than a predetermined standard. Note that the notification frequency of the second service advertisement set by this method is, for example, once every few minutes to every few tens of minutes, but the present disclosure is not particularly limited and can be set as appropriate. Furthermore, the notification frequency of the second service advertisement set by this method may be set to be higher as the driving skill is higher than the predetermined standard.
[0061] (Intention Judgment Department) The intention determination unit 316 determines whether the driver has an intention to improve his / her driving skills. Specifically, the intention determination unit 316 determines whether the driver's intention to improve his / her driving skills is higher than a predetermined standard. Here, the intention determination unit 316 may make this determination based on the usage history of the service related to the first service advertisement. For example, if the driver has used the service related to the first service advertisement a predetermined number of times or more within a predetermined period up to the present, the intention determination unit 316 may determine that the intention is higher than the predetermined standard. Note that the predetermined period is, for example, within the past six months from the present, but the present disclosure is not limited to this and can be set appropriately. Furthermore, the predetermined number of times is, for example, several times to several tens of times, but the present disclosure is not limited to this and can be set appropriately. Alternatively, the intention determination unit 316 may determine whether the driver has the intention based on the driver's response using the input device 60 to a question posed to the driver using the notification device 50 of the vehicle 100.
[0062] (Notification destination setting section) The notification destination setting unit 317 sets the driver as the notification destination of the first service advertisement when the intention determination unit 316 determines that the driver's intention to improve their driving skills is higher than a predetermined standard. Furthermore, the notification destination setting unit 317 sets a passenger or a specific other person as the notification destination of the first service advertisement when the intention determination unit 316 does not determine that the driver's intention to improve their driving skills is higher than the predetermined standard. Furthermore, when the intention determination unit 316 does not determine that the driver's intention to improve their driving skills is higher than the predetermined standard and there is a passenger in the vehicle 100, the notification destination setting unit 317 sets the passenger as the notification destination of the first service advertisement. On the other hand, when the intention determination unit 316 does not determine that the driver's intention to improve their driving skills is higher than the predetermined standard and there is no passenger in the vehicle 100, the notification destination setting unit 317 sets a specific other person as the notification destination of the first service advertisement.

[0092] (2. Summary) As described above, the driving skill improvement system 1000 according to this embodiment is a system for improving the driving skill of a driver of a vehicle 100. Specifically, the processing unit 310 of the server device 300 included in the driving skill improvement system 1000 (i) determines the driving skill of the driver, and (ii) notifies the driver of a first service advertisement, which is an advertisement for a service that can be used to improve the driver's driving skill, based on the driving skill determination result. In particular, the processing unit 310 of the server device 300 increases the notification frequency of the first service advertisement when the driver's driving skill is not determined to be higher than a predetermined standard, compared to the notification frequency of the first service advertisement when the driver's driving skill is determined to be higher than the predetermined standard.
[0093] With this configuration, the advertising effectiveness of the first service advertisement can be increased for drivers whose driving skills are not determined to be higher than a predetermined standard, thereby helping them improve their driving skills, while also preventing drivers whose driving skills are determined to be higher than the predetermined standard from feeling annoyed by the first service advertisement.
[0094] Furthermore, the processing unit 310 of the server device 300 further determines whether or not the driver has an intention to improve his / her driving skills. Then, the processing unit 310 (iii) notifies the driver of the first service advertisement if it is determined that the driver's intention to improve his / her driving skills is higher than a predetermined standard, and (iv) notifies a passenger of the vehicle 100 or a specific other person of the first service advertisement if it is not determined that the driver's intention to improve his / her driving skills is higher than the predetermined standard.
[0095] According to this configuration, even if the driver is not motivated to improve his / her driving skills, the first service advertisement notified to the passenger or the specific other person can motivate the driver and encourage the driver to improve his / her driving skills. Therefore, with the cooperation of the passenger or the specific other person, the driver's driving skills of the vehicle 100 can be improved.
